Ray Dalio is the founder of Bridgewater Associates, one of the world’s largest hedge funds, known for its unique “principles-based” culture and systematic investment approach. Dalio’s investment philosophy emphasizes diversified portfolios, risk parity, and the importance of understanding economic cycles in shaping investment decisions. He has authored several books, including “Principles: Life & Work,” in which he details his management philosophies, personal experiences, and life lessons.

Ray Dalio's Q1 2026 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2026, Ray Dalio held 1,254 positions worth $22.4B, down 18% from $27.4B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 41% of the portfolio.

Ray Dalio withdrew a net $4.49B in Q1 2026, closing 261 positions and reducing 487 holdings. Its most notable exit was Salesforce, an estimated $512M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 29% of assets, up from 28% a quarter earlier, followed by Industrials and Consumer Discretionary.

Against the trend, Ray Dalio opened a new position in TSMC worth $364M.

  • Ray Dalio's largest Q1 2026 buy was TSMC: 1,077,079 shares worth $364M.
  • Ray Dalio added most to Amazon in Q1 2026, an estimated $537M increase.
  • Ray Dalio's biggest Q1 2026 reduction was iShares Core S&P 500 ETF, cutting an estimated $1.03B.
  • Ray Dalio fully exited Salesforce in Q1 2026, selling an estimated $512M.
  • Ray Dalio's ten largest holdings make up 41% of its $22.4B portfolio in Q1 2026.
  • Ray Dalio opened 214 new positions and closed 261 in Q1 2026.
  • Ray Dalio's portfolio value fell 18% quarter-over-quarter to $22.4B.

Based on Bridgewater Associates's 13F filing for Q1 2026, filed 15 May 2026.
